EPL: Cole Palmer’s move to Chelsea takes Boehly’s transfer spending to £1billion

Cole Palmer has joined Chelsea from Manchester City in a deal worth up to £42.5million.

The Blues will pay an initial £40m with the rest made up of add-ons.

City initially valued their academy talent at £50m, but reached a compromise for Palmer with a £40m fee and a further £2.5m due in add-ons.

The deal for the midfielder takes Chelsea’s spending since Todd Boehly took over the club last year to £1bn.

Chelsea’s spending under Todd Boehly:

Moises Caciedo £115m
Enzo Fernandez £106.7m
Mykhailo Mudryk £88m
Wesley Fofana £73m
Marc Cucurella £62m
Romeo Lavia £58m
Christopher Nkunku £53m
Raheem Sterling £47.5m
Cole Palmer £42.5m
Axel Disasi £38m
Benoit Badiashille £35m
Kalidou Koulibaly £34m
Nicolas Jackson £32m
Noni Madueke £29m
Malo Gutso £26m
Robert Sanchez £25m
Lesley Ugochukwu £23.8m
Carney Chukwuemeka £20m
Andrey Santos £18m
Deivid Washington £17m
Pierre Emerick-Aubameyang £12m
Joao Felix £9.7m (loan fee)
Gabriel Slonina £9m
David Fofana £8m
Jimmy-Jay Morgan £3m
Denis Zakaria £3m (loan fee)
